Output f881ec64958b52c7c4b78943e241a7c2d6eec10fe3956434206fd0fd8c214867:2

value
20775514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1ec01f4e69d7d731a633079648629e108ac0cb OP_EQUAL
address
3D6bE6wRsgGyDfbQcTMMzdu2U3mJX31qPA
transaction
f881ec64958b52c7c4b78943e241a7c2d6eec10fe3956434206fd0fd8c214867
spent
true